Key Skills for Data Science A successful career in data science demands a versatile skill set that spans various domains. Here’s an overview of the essential skills crucial for excelling in this dynamic field: Programming Skills: Proficiency in languages like Python or R is fundamental for data manipulation, analysis, and modeling. Statistical Knowledge: A solid foundation in statistical concepts allows for accurate interpretation of data and informed decision-making. Mathematics: Mathematical proficiency, particularly in areas such as linear algebra and calculus, underpins advanced machine learning algorithms. Machine Learning: Understanding and applying machine learning algorithms for predictive modeling and pattern recognition is essential. Data Cleaning and Wrangling: The ability to preprocess and clean raw data, ensuring it is ready for analysis, is a crucial skill. Data Visualization: Proficient use of visualization tools like Matplotlib, Seaborn, or Tableau to communicate insights effectively. Big Data Technologies: Familiarity with tools like Hadoop, Spark, or Apache Flink for handling large datasets. Database Knowledge: Competence in working with databases (SQL and NoSQL) is essential for data retrieval and storage. Domain Expertise: Understanding the industry or domain you are working in enhances the relevance and applicability of your analyses. Communication Skills: The ability to convey complex findings clearly and understandably to non-technical stakeholders. Problem-Solving Aptitude: A strong analytical mindset to approach problems and devise effective data-driven solutions. Curiosity and Continuous Learning: A thirst for knowledge and staying abreast of evolving tools and techniques is vital in this rapidly changing field. Combining these skills provides a robust foundation for a successful career in data science, allowing professionals to navigate the complexities of analyzing and deriving insights from diverse datasets.
